Women In Film is a non-profit organization dedicated to advancing gender equity in the entertainment industry, encouraging creative projects by women, nonbinary, and trans people, and expanding and enhancing their portrayals in all forms of global media.
Founded in 1973, WIF focuses on advocacy and education- provides scholarships, grants, and film finishing funds-and works to preserve the legacies of all women working in the entertainment community.

Transforming Hollywood Work - Resources for a Safer Hollywood "After" #MeToo
This panel discussion brings together advocates working in the screen industries to discuss the difficult questions still facing workers in the industry post #MeToo. The goal of this event is to move beyond awareness by providing both practical tools as well as strategies to navigate and change intersectional power dynamics and unconscious biases embedded in the screen industries.

Founded in 1973 as Women In Film Los Angeles, WIF advocates for and advances the careers of women working in the screen industries-in front of and behind the camera, across all levels of experience-to achieve parity and transform culture.
We work to change culture through our distinguished programs, including mentoring, speaker and screening series, a production training program, writing labs, film finishing funds, legal aid, and an annual financing intensive. WIF advocates for gender parity through research, education, and media campaigns. And, we build a community centered around these goals, anchored by our signature events, including the WIF Annual Gala and Female Oscar Nominees Party, along with programs honoring the achievements of women in Hollywood, like the Legacy Series. Membership is open to all screen industry professionals.
